Raiden IV comes to mind (change of pace indeed). Since the Japanese version is quite expensive (unlike the US one), you might want to try it out (as well as Raiden III and Shikigami no Shiro 1-2-3) on a PC before. DLC allows you to play Raiden IV as a fairy, which is not possible (thus far) with the coin-op version.
You can also get Shiki III for the Wii (localised US version) or the PC (official release, not the hacked ROM).

Bee Cool wrote:I'll keep eschatos in mind but from what I've seen I don't like the changing perspective.
The changing perspective is balls, but very infrequent and not that much of a hindrance when it does happen.

You'd be doing yourself an extreme disservice by not giving it a chance. The game is packed with modes, and Advanced scoring is actually pretty clever and very enjoyable. Even if you never touched the main game, Judgement Silversword and Cardinal Sins are both A+ shooters. I'd say Eschatos is a must-have for any good 360 shooter collection, and I'd place it above a number of Cave titles.

Trouble Witches is legitimately really good. Don't let the copious amounts of loli fool you. The scoring system is a really great spin on bullet cancelling, and the shop mechanic is a nice touch.

iconoclast wrote:Strania: The Stella Machina on XBLA. It's an awesome mecha game by G.rev, and it only costs $10.
Probably my favorite XBLA shmup. Needs more love :d The scoring system won't keep you addicted for long after you've achieved maximum end bonus, but reaching it is a very fun challenge as is just 1ccing.

The DLC is $5 and is even better than the main game, making both a must buy IMO. For more casual players the games netcode is great, I think it's a fun coop game to shoot through.
